Quick Verdict
These treats are generally well-received for their flavor, but there are significant concerns about their small size, which can be a choking hazard for larger dogs. Additionally, recent reviews suggest a declining trend in quality and satisfaction.

Bottom Line
While the flavor is a hit, the small size makes these treats unsuitable for many dogs. Buyers need to consider the risk of choking and the declining quality reported in recent reviews. It is best suited for small dogs or as an occasional treat for larger breeds with proper monitoring.
